What is a Kitchen Extractor Fan?
A kitchen extractor fan, also referred to as a range hood or Cooker Extractor Hood Cooker, is developed to remove airborne grease, smoke, steam, and odors produced throughout cooking. By drawing in air, filtering it, and then venting it outside or recirculating it, these fans guarantee a clean and pleasant cooking environment.

Considerations When Choosing a Kitchen Extractor Fan
Selecting the right kitchen extractor fan includes numerous considerations to ensure optimal efficiency and aesthetics. Here's a list of factors to assess:
| Consideration | Information |
|---|---|
| Size and Capacity | Select a fan that matches cooktop width; normally, the CFM rating must be 100 CFM for every 10,000 BTUs of cooking power. |
| Ducted vs. Ductless | Ducted is usually more effective however needs setup work, while ductless is simpler to establish but requires regular filter changes. |
| Sound Level | Search for fans with lower sones (a measure of sound); quieter options are ideal for open-concept areas. |
| Design and Finish | Think about the kitchen's general design-- choose a finish that matches existing devices and decor. |
| Alleviate of Cleaning | Decide for detachable filters and smooth surfaces that minimize maintenance efforts. |
| Budget plan | Establish a budget plan, keeping in mind that higher-end models often provide enhanced features. |
Installation and Maintenance
Correct setup and upkeep of your kitchen Extractor Hoods For Kitchens fan are essential for optimal efficiency. Here are some basic installation guidelines:
- Location: The fan needs to preferably be installed 26-30 inches above the cooktop.
- Expert Installation: For ducted designs, hiring an expert installer is advised to ensure venting is done properly.
- Regular Maintenance: Clean filters every 30 days and replace them as necessary to prevent airflow obstruction and keep efficiency.
Upkeep Tips
- Wipe the Exterior: Use mild soap and water for stainless steel surfaces to keep them smudge-free.
- Examine Ducts: Regularly check ducts for clogs or grease buildup.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How do I know what size extractor fan I need?
The size of the extractor fan need to normally match the width of your cooktop. Furthermore, think about the fan's CFM (cubic feet per minute) ranking in relation to your cooking power. A suggested formula is 100 CFM for each 10,000 BTUs.
2. Can I install an extractor fan myself?
For ductless designs, installation can be straightforward. However, for ducted designs, hiring a professional is recommended to ensure correct venting and compliance with regional building regulations.
3. How often should I clean the fan filters?
It's normally advised to tidy grease filters every 30 days, while charcoal filters ought to be changed roughly every 6 months, or more often if you cook typically.
4. Do kitchen extractor fans require a lot of energy?
Modern extractor fans are created to be energy-efficient, taking in less power while providing efficient ventilation. Look for ENERGY STAR-rated designs for much better effectiveness.
